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						64af2aafda 
					 
					
						
						
							
							core, core/vm: added gas price variance table  
						
						... 
						
						
						
						This implements 1b & 1c of EIP150 by adding a new GasTable which must be
returned from the RuleSet config method. This table is used to determine
the gas prices for the current epoch.
Please note that when the CreateBySuicide gas price is set it is assumed
that we're in the new epoch phase.
In addition this PR will serve as temporary basis while refactorisation
in being done in the EVM64 PR, which will substentially overhaul the gas
price code. 
						
						
					 
					
						2016-10-14 18:09:17 +02:00 
						 
				 
			
				
					
						
							
							
								Felix Lange 
							
						 
					 
					
						
						
							
						
						1b7b2ba216 
					 
					
						
						
							
							tests: update test files from github.com/ethereum/tests @ 45bc1d21d3c1  
						
						... 
						
						
						
						Two new tests are skipped because they're buggy. Making some newer
random state tests work required implementing the 'compressed return
value encoding'. 
						
						
					 
					
						2016-10-06 15:36:21 +02:00 
						 
				 
			
				
					
						
							
							
								Péter Szilágyi 
							
						 
					 
					
						
						
							
						
						2c2e389b77 
					 
					
						
						
							
							cmd, core, eth, miner, params, tests: finalize the DAO fork  
						
						
						
						
					 
					
						2016-07-15 16:52:55 +03:00 
						 
				 
			
				
					
						
							
							
								Péter Szilágyi 
							
						 
					 
					
						
						
							
						
						461cdb593b 
					 
					
						
						
							
							core, params, tests: add DAO hard-fork balance moves  
						
						
						
						
					 
					
						2016-07-15 16:52:55 +03:00 
						 
				 
			
				
					
						
							
							
								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						4f4d2b6474 
					 
					
						
						
							
							tests: updated homestead tests  
						
						
						
						
					 
					
						2016-02-18 10:08:18 +01: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						371871d685 
					 
					
						
						
							
							parmas, crypto, core, core/vm: homestead consensus protocol changes  
						
						... 
						
						
						
						* change gas cost for contract creating txs
* invalidate signature with s value greater than secp256k1 N / 2
* OOG contract creation if not enough gas to store code
* new difficulty adjustment algorithm
* new DELEGATECALL op code 
						
						
					 
					
						2016-02-18 10:08:11 +01: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						220b0bf6e5 
					 
					
						
						
							
							Update common test files  
						
						
						
						
					 
					
						2015-11-20 12:53:36 +01: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						145366c07e 
					 
					
						
						
							
							tests: update JSON files, add new wrappers  
						
						
						
						
					 
					
						2015-10-23 14:25:18 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						5621308949 
					 
					
						
						
							
							tests: add test for StateTests/stCallCodes.json  
						
						
						
						
					 
					
						2015-09-21 11:34:02 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						075815e5ff 
					 
					
						
						
							
							tests: update common test wrappers and test files  
						
						
						
						
					 
					
						2015-09-18 13:08:36 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						fe8093b71f 
					 
					
						
						
							
							Add TestBcForkUncleTests and update JSON files  
						
						
						
						
					 
					
						2015-08-31 16:45:00 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						7324176f70 
					 
					
						
						
							
							Add tests for uncle timestamps and refactor timestamp type  
						
						
						
						
					 
					
						2015-08-25 04:46:11 +02:00 
						 
				 
			
				
					
						
							
							
								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						36f7fe61c3 
					 
					
						
						
							
							core, tests: Double SUICIDE fix  
						
						
						
						
					 
					
						2015-08-20 18:22:50 +02:00 
						 
				 
			
				
					
						
							
							
								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						71d32f54f7 
					 
					
						
						
							
							core, miner: added difficulty bomb  
						
						
						
						
					 
					
						2015-08-05 13:09:09 +02:00 
						 
				 
			
				
					
						
							
							
								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						03c39d4fc0 
					 
					
						
						
							
							tests: updated  
						
						
						
						
					 
					
						2015-07-29 15:01:42 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						0b53a5c673 
					 
					
						
						
							
							Update Ethereum JSON test files and wrappers  
						
						
						
						
					 
					
						2015-07-08 13:08:42 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						ff97059a99 
					 
					
						
						
							
							Update Ethereum JSON tests, skip failing  
						
						
						
						
					 
					
						2015-07-03 09:40:07 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						8f372c867d 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-06-16 12:09:25 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						e885a2912b 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-06-09 15:39:24 +02:00 
						 
				 
			
				
					
						
							
							
								Jeffrey Wilcke 
							
						 
					 
					
						
						
							
						
						122d2db095 
					 
					
						
						
							
							Merge pull request  #1150  from fjl/fix-jumpdest  
						
						... 
						
						
						
						core/vm: improve JUMPDEST analysis 
						
						
					 
					
						2015-06-03 09:11:56 -07:00 
						 
				 
			
				
					
						
							
							
								Felix Lange 
							
						 
					 
					
						
						
							
						
						c9ed9d253a 
					 
					
						
						
							
							tests/files: update tests to d309b4679a58d2  
						
						
						
						
					 
					
						2015-06-03 16:25:06 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						8a76b45253 
					 
					
						
						
							
							Use older version of stSpecialTest until JUMPDEST fix is merged  
						
						
						
						
					 
					
						2015-06-02 12:25:43 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						8962af2e42 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-06-02 12:15:25 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						5a692ba4f6 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-06-01 22:34:44 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						b4818a003a 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-05-29 13:12:54 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						03faccfb08 
					 
					
						
						
							
							tests: updated  
						
						
						
						
					 
					
						2015-05-26 13:48:10 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						36419defd1 
					 
					
						
						
							
							Update Ethereum JSON test files  
						
						
						
						
					 
					
						2015-05-18 12:45:24 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						830bdb1cfd 
					 
					
						
						
							
							Update Ethereum JSON tests  
						
						
						
						
					 
					
						2015-05-15 16:08:00 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						2b716aec54 
					 
					
						
						
							
							Update JSON test files  
						
						
						
						
					 
					
						2015-05-07 12:44:29 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						2a61611c4f 
					 
					
						
						
							
							Update JSON tests  
						
						
						
						
					 
					
						2015-04-27 19:09:20 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						8ec8bff11c 
					 
					
						
						
							
							Update github.com/ethereum/tests files  
						
						
						
						
					 
					
						2015-04-22 23:16:18 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						2d8a2d0c99 
					 
					
						
						
							
							Update JSON tests  
						
						
						
						
					 
					
						2015-04-15 22:36:33 +02:00 
						 
				 
			
				
					
						
							
							
								Gustav Simonsson 
							
						 
					 
					
						
						
							
						
						1e18f4544b 
					 
					
						
						
							
							Update JSON test files  
						
						
						
						
					 
					
						2015-04-10 11:52:31 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						4558e04c0d 
					 
					
						
						
							
							Merge commit 'f6bd4b16e38f9cacd57b57befdeeaed789a473c4' into develop  
						
						
						
						
					 
					
						2015-04-03 12:29:13 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						fd5c5b2969 
					 
					
						
						
							
							Merge commit '812cbff1a28d89b44a0c8c5a210ac61c7e19da35' into develop  
						
						
						
						
					 
					
						2015-04-03 10:50:18 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						109b27b552 
					 
					
						
						
							
							Merge commit '4e3ffbcf9bae7e44e45fd1b6e504b3645040d73c' into develop  
						
						
						
						
					 
					
						2015-04-01 17:50:19 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						516423cdac 
					 
					
						
						
							
							Merge commit 'f801183b8bea24ce9988fbd06c2f17fedfc3587f' into develop  
						
						
						
						
					 
					
						2015-04-01 17:41:58 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						2ef0bc03ec 
					 
					
						
						
							
							Merge commit 'ec181b308addc30c04973e9058960d579c84eef5' into develop  
						
						
						
						
					 
					
						2015-03-31 16:25:22 +02: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						d0fa0a234d 
					 
					
						
						
							
							Merge commit 'a718515b3d43f00497231f981b5ea757b71d55ff' into develop  
						
						
						
						
					 
					
						2015-03-26 13:14:24 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						d6da533345 
					 
					
						
						
							
							Merge commit '24066dca4646c8a376aa5dfbceec0a4b3f872c11' into develop  
						
						
						
						
					 
					
						2015-03-24 13:39:49 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						4877e52c15 
					 
					
						
						
							
							Merge commit '58c6cc8fd7ff8a27004ed62d912e0a61ae1b73bb' into develop  
						
						
						
						
					 
					
						2015-03-24 11:22:58 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						b4a51de602 
					 
					
						
						
							
							Merge commit 'f144a95940a5df0809bb028eef7b337125423602' into develop  
						
						
						
						
					 
					
						2015-03-19 21:14:51 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						e67d32b467 
					 
					
						
						
							
							Merge commit '85fa3790ac9f67232f0e31e7f861c66ef0e0047e' into develop  
						
						
						
						
					 
					
						2015-03-18 22:13:08 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						9663493ba0 
					 
					
						
						
							
							Merge commit 'dffaa678f966f87dcd011671a16b554b29a37549' into develop  
						
						
						
						
					 
					
						2015-03-17 12:02:50 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						3a88da578f 
					 
					
						
						
							
							Merge commit '6051345bc9ab8ccf74a49c43342771e0c2cba588' into develop  
						
						
						
						
					 
					
						2015-03-12 22:32:05 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						2ae90e1eba 
					 
					
						
						
							
							Merge commit '3ff7a627d1921be0aeacdd8eb2853ba4537487eb' into develop  
						
						
						
						
					 
					
						2015-03-12 20:01:46 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						d1c872bace 
					 
					
						
						
							
							Merge commit '412e8b0e377bd89fc8fc858bd09c89deee805c1e' into develop  
						
						
						
						
					 
					
						2015-03-12 19:15:12 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						96496888ed 
					 
					
						
						
							
							Merge commit '92c6150199395eea6c9893b631cc990e3ff72a33' into develop  
						
						
						
						
					 
					
						2015-03-12 00:57:28 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						21fd722abc 
					 
					
						
						
							
							Merge commit '3deb470b2d07d28040a381722022cdf8867a829a' into poc-9  
						
						
						
						
					 
					
						2015-03-09 11:43:46 +01:00 
						 
				 
			
				
					
						
							
							
								obscuren 
							
						 
					 
					
						
						
							
						
						93cdffca3a 
					 
					
						
						
							
							Merge commit 'c1cafb56d5da57a44f1d766c5299f11664b93921' into poc-9  
						
						
						
						
					 
					
						2015-03-09 01:02:12 +01:00